ballpoint Posted October 21, 2021 Share Posted October 21, 2021 Aurora have shops all over Thailand. They sell their own standard baht weight bars, which are easy to sell at any branch, or you can buy them online. The current buying and selling prices are displayed on their website. https://www.aurora.co.th/ 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
